Tuner Offsets

For people who want to use sweetened tunings (a la Peterson) or have Buzz Feiten guitars, it would be useful to be able to set per-string offsets in cents.

I use my Shure GLXD16+ tuner’s compensation feature to tune half-step down (Eb/D#) while it still displays the standard string names: E, A, D, G, B, E.
And the reason is, we talk about the strings as if we were in standard tuning, so this avoids any confusion.
